Оператор SQL UPDATE берет свое начало в ранней разработке систем управления реляционными базами данных (СУБД) в 1970-х годах, в частности, с появлением языка структурированных запросов (SQL) компанией IBM. Первоначально разработанный для управления данными в табличном формате, SQL предоставлял стандартизированный способ манипулирования и извлечения данных. Оператор UPDATE стал важнейшим компонентом SQL, позволяя пользователям изменять существующие записи в таблице базы данных. С течением лет, по мере развития и усложнения баз данных, синтаксис и функциональность оператора UPDATE были улучшены для поддержки различных условий, объединений и подзапросов, что сделало его мощным инструментом для манипулирования данными. Сегодня оператор UPDATE является неотъемлемой частью SQL, широко используемой на различных платформах СУБД для поддержания и управления целостностью данных. **Краткий ответ:** Оператор SQL UPDATE появился в 1970-х годах с разработкой SQL для реляционных баз данных, позволяя пользователям изменять существующие записи. Его синтаксис и возможности со временем развивались, став основным инструментом для манипулирования данными в современных СУБД.
Оператор SQL UPDATE — это мощный инструмент для изменения существующих записей в базе данных, обладающий рядом преимуществ и недостатков. Одним из ключевых преимуществ является его способность эффективно изменять несколько записей одновременно, что может сэкономить время и снизить необходимость в повторяющихся командах. Кроме того, он позволяет выполнять точные обновления с использованием условий, гарантируя, что будут изменены только нужные данные. Однако основным недостатком является риск непреднамеренной потери или повреждения данных; если предложение WHERE используется неправильно, это может привести к непреднамеренным обновлениям во многих записях. Кроме того, частые обновления могут привести к проблемам с производительностью в больших базах данных, поскольку для блокировки и регистрации изменений могут потребоваться дополнительные ресурсы. В целом, хотя оператор UPDATE необходим для поддержания целостности данных, необходимо тщательно продумать его реализацию, чтобы избежать потенциальных ловушек. **Краткий ответ:** Оператор SQL UPDATE позволяет эффективно изменять записи, но несет в себе риски непреднамеренной потери данных и проблем с производительностью, если используется неосторожно.
Обновление операторов SQL может представлять несколько проблем, с которыми должны справиться администраторы и разработчики баз данных. Одной из важных проблем является обеспечение целостности данных, поскольку одновременные обновления несколькими пользователями могут привести к условиям гонки или потере обновлений, если не управлять ими должным образом. Кроме того, создание оператора обновления, который точно нацелен на нужные строки, не затрагивая непреднамеренно другие, требует тщательного рассмотрения предложения WHERE. Проблемы с производительностью могут возникнуть при обновлении больших наборов данных, потенциально блокируя таблицы и вызывая задержки в реагировании приложения. Кроме того, ведение четкого аудиторского журнала для изменений, внесенных с помощью операторов обновления, может быть сложным, особенно в системах, где отслеживание исторических данных имеет решающее значение. В целом, эти проблемы требуют глубокого понимания синтаксиса SQL, управления транзакциями и принципов проектирования баз данных. **Краткий ответ:** Проблемы обновления операторов SQL включают обеспечение целостности данных среди одновременных обновлений, точное нацеливание на определенные строки с помощью предложения WHERE, управление проблемами производительности во время больших обновлений и ведение аудиторского журнала для изменений. Для этого требуется тщательное планирование и понимание SQL и управления базами данных.
При поиске талантов или помощи в обновлении операторов SQL важно найти людей или ресурсы, которые обладают глубоким пониманием управления базами данных и синтаксиса SQL. Это может включать обращение к опытным администраторам баз данных, разработчикам программного обеспечения или аналитикам данных, которые могут предоставить информацию о лучших практиках для создания эффективных запросов на обновление. Кроме того, онлайн-форумы, сообщества кодировщиков и образовательные платформы могут служить ценными ресурсами для устранения конкретных проблем или изучения передовых методов, связанных с обновлениями SQL. Независимо от того, ищете ли вы внештатную помощь или руководство от коллег, использование этих ресурсов может значительно повысить вашу способность выполнять эффективные обновления в вашей базе данных. **Краткий ответ:** Чтобы найти талант или помощь в обновлении операторов SQL, рассмотрите возможность связаться с опытными специалистами по базам данных, использовать онлайн-форумы или изучить образовательные платформы, которые фокусируются на SQL и управлении базами данных.
Easiio находится на переднем крае технологических инноваций, предлагая комплексный набор услуг по разработке программного обеспечения, адаптированных к требованиям современного цифрового ландшафта. Наши экспертные знания охватывают такие передовые области, как машинное обучение, нейронные сети, блокчейн, криптовалюты, приложения Large Language Model (LLM) и сложные алгоритмы. Используя эти передовые технологии, Easiio создает индивидуальные решения, которые способствуют успеху и эффективности бизнеса. Чтобы изучить наши предложения или инициировать запрос на обслуживание, мы приглашаем вас посетить нашу страницу разработки программного обеспечения.
TEL: 866-460-7666
ЭЛЕКТРОННАЯ ПОЧТА:contact@easiio.com
АДРЕС: 11501 Дублинский бульвар, офис 200, Дублин, Калифорния, 94568